Mesozoic Flashcards
What are the three periods of the Mesozoic era?
Triassic, Jurassic, Cretaceous
True or False: The Mesozoic era is known as the Age of Reptiles.
True
Fill in the blank: The Mesozoic era lasted from _____ to _____ million years ago.
252 to 66
Which period is known for the dominance of dinosaurs?
Jurassic
What major event marks the end of the Mesozoic era?
The Cretaceous-Paleogene extinction event
What type of climate characterized the Mesozoic era?
Warm and humid climate
Multiple Choice: Which of the following was NOT a dominant group during the Mesozoic? A) Dinosaurs B) Mammals C) Insects
B) Mammals
What significant geological event occurred during the Mesozoic era?
The breakup of Pangaea
